Peter Gaster of Kings Road Tyres and the National Chairman of the NTDA was appointed this week as the new vice chairman of the Tyre Industry Federation Board at their AGM on Tuesday.
Peter takes over from Steve Tidmarsh of Kumho Tyres who represents the Imported Tyre Manufacturers Association on the board and who stood down at the meeting. Jim Rickard of Michelin, the Inaugural Chairman of the TIF continues as Chairman.
